1948 first edition hardcover as pictured. The story of a five year sailing cruise down the east coast of the United States, across the Bahama banks and through the greater and lesser Antilles. Includes 15 halftones, five charts and an extensive appendix descibing islands, ports and equipment. Binding is firm. Blue cloth boards with black and gold stamping show only light edge wear. Pictorial endpapers are lightly tanned. Owner's name on FFEP. Text appears clean and unmarked. Dust jacket is faded over spine and price clipped with multiple small tears and chips at edges.
